/*
 * Hey plugin folks — this module controls pagination for the Quillhopper
 * public REST API. Cursor-based paging only; offset params were retired
 * last spring. If you request more than the max page size we silently
 * clamp, so don't bother fighting it. Cursors expire, so paginate promptly.
 * The knobs you'll care about are defined right here.
 */

tuning constants:
QUOTAS = {
    "druwyn": 5,
    "holix": 5,
    "zorath": 5,
    "holwyn": 10,
}

**Vendor note: Inkmill markdown pipeline**

Rendering for Parchway docs is outsourced to Inkmill under an annual contract, renewing each March. They handle sanitization and PDF export; we own the upload queue. SLA: 4-hour response on rendering failures. Escalate only after two failed retries. Their support desk is reachable at the address below.

billing contact of hahaf-baguf = zorael.tammir.jorius@sivrelhq.internal

# Approvals — NightWeave Backfill Scheduler

Hey future maintainers! NightWeave kicks off our nightly data backfills at 02:00 and generally behaves itself. But any change to cron expressions, retry budgets, or the job priority table needs a proper approval — we learned that the hard way after the infamous double-backfill incident. Open a change request, tag the schedulers channel, and wait for a thumbs-up. Final approval always comes from the person named below.

account owner for fajep-yagef: Kasix Eliiel